Charles James II

The Cochran Firm
306 N Main St
Tuskegee, AL, 36083

Practice Information


Law Firm Name:
The Cochran Firm

Similar Items


Walter E McGowan

Terry L Butts

Cary L Dozier

Michael W Rountree

Location